AValve stem
[Fully closed at the factory, when connecting the piping, when evacuating, and when charging additional refrigerant. Open fully after the operations above are completed.]
BStopper pin [Prevents the valve stem from turning 90° or more.]
CPacking (accessory)
DDistributer (gas) (option)
Mount packing (accessory) securely to the valve flange so that gas does not leak. (screw tightening torque is 43 N·m (430 kg·cm). Apply a coat of refrigerating machine oil to both surfaces of the packing.
D’ Connecting pipe (accessory)
[Use packing and securely install this pipe to the valve flange so that gas leakage will not occur. (tightening torque: 25 N·m (250 kg·cm)) Coat both surfaces of the packing with refrigerator oil.]
EOpen (operate slowly)
FCap, copper packing
[Remove the cap and operate the valve stem. Always reinstall the cap after operation is completed. (valve stem cap tightening torque: 25 N·m (250 kg·cm) or more)]
GService port
[Use this port to evacuate the refrigerant piping and add an additional charge at the site.

Always reinstall the cap after operation is completed. (service port cap tightening torque: 14 N·m (140 kg·cm) or more)]
HFlare nut
[Tightening torque: 80 N·m (800 kg·cm) ···liquid, 55 N·m (550 kg·cm) ···oil blance

H’ Flare nut
Tightening torque is 55 N·m (550 kg·cm). Use a double spanner to open and close. Apply a coat of refrigerating machine oil to the flare bonding surface.

JField piping
[Braze to the connecting pipe. (when brazing, use unoxidized brazing.)]
Appropriate tightening torque by torque wrench
Copper pipe external dia. (mm) | Tightening torque (N·m) / (kg·cm) | |||
ø 6.35 |
| 14 to 18 | / 140 to 180 | |
ø 9.52 |
| 35 to 42 | / 350 to 420 | |
ø 12.7 |
| 50 to 57.5 / 500 to 575 | ||

ø 15.88 |
| 75 to 80 | / 750 to 800 | |
ø 19.05 |
| 100 to 140 | / 1000 to 1400 | |

Note:
If a torque wrench is not available, use the following method as a standard
When you tighten the flare nut with a wrench, you will reach a point where the tightening torque will abrupt increase. Turn the flare nut beyond this point by the angle shown in the table above.
Caution:
Always remove the connecting pipe from the ball valve and braze it outside the unit.
-Brazing the connecting pipe while it is installed will heat the ball valve and cause trouble or gas leakage. The piping, etc. inside the unit may also be burned.
